Since maybe Snyder will focus on retaining proven players instead of signing unproven or washed up free agents (or overpaying legitimate good players like Randle El), I was thinking of who are the most important players for this team to keep. I came up with this list:
1) Portis
2) Taylor
3) Washington
4) Cooley
5) Rogers
6) Daniels
I don't buy into this offensive line as the second comign of the Hogs. Samuels is a false start machine, Janses gets beat by any decent DE, and Thomas is aging. In fact, I value Thomas the most of the five.
Also, notice Moss doesn't make the list. This is a running team first, and they'll have to dramatically overpay Moss to keep him around. I think that Randle El, with his speed, could do everything Moss does if they took him off of returns. With what Portis is paid, the offense should be focused on him (unless Danny wants to spend on offense and let the tremendous defensive talent depart, as he did Pierce who's a top-5 MLB these days). I'd like to see our top-10 pick this draft go towards a tall Burress-like WR. This will give Campbell a much-needed Go-To/bailout guy next season.
